
Product Description
The HAKKO 394 is a battery-powered suction pickup with a built-in vacuum pump, manufactured from ESD-safe materials. The unit is designed for spot picking using interchangeable pads and nozzles. The unit comes with a bent nozzle (1.1 mm), pads in 5 mm and 10 mm diameter, two AAA alkaline batteries for trial use, and an instruction manual.
Application and Operation
The HAKKO 394 is activated by placing the chosen pad close to the surface of the object to be lifted and pressing the button. Suction remains active as long as the button is held; release the button to release the object. The choice of nozzle and pad should be based on the object's size and surface type. Batteries must be inserted correctly (+/-) and can be replaced by removing the cover according to the manual.
Design and Maintenance
- The unit is light (approx. 43 g without batteries) and compact (130 mm × 29 mm × 22 mm without nozzle).
- The materials are stated as ESD-safe.
- To prevent pump failure, dust and foreign objects must not be sucked into the unit.
- Use only recommended battery types; do not mix new and old batteries.

Specifications
- Model: HAKKO 394
- Dimensions: 130 mm × 29 mm × 22 mm (not incl. nozzle)
- Weight: Approx. 43 g (not incl. batteries)
- Suction power: 120 gf (with pad Ø 10 mm)
- Power supply: Two AAA batteries
- Battery life: Approx. 30,000 suction cycles (with alkaline batteries)
- Included accessories: Bent nozzle (1.1 mm), pads Ø 5 mm and Ø 10 mm, two alkaline AAA batteries, instruction manual
- Material: ESD-safe materials
- Options/spare parts (indicated in manufacturer documentation): several nozzles and pads (e.g., bent nozzle 0.26/0.4/1.1 mm; pads 3/5/7/10 mm; straight nozzle 1.1 mm) with corresponding part numbers
